Chhattisgarh produces approximately 20–25% of India's bamboo. The state has extensive forests, especially in Bastar, Dhamtari, Bilaspur, and Raigarh districts. Dendrocalamus strictus is the common bamboo species in the region. Chhattisgarh's bamboo output supports local industries such as paper, handicrafts, and construction. State government policies promote bamboo cultivation for economic development and tribal livelihood.
